Job Description:
- Welcoming and sitting diners comfortably in the dining section.
- Taking customers’ food and drink orders.
- Collaborating with the kitchen and bar staff for prompt and correct delivery of orders.
- Memorizing the menu and recommend appetizers, meals and drinks from restaurant wine stock.
- Delivering a memorable dining experience by resolving all customer issues promptly.
- Assisting with the tidying of tables, clearing leftovers and keeping the dining area neat and pleasant.
- Setting tables and rearranging the dining area to accommodate larger groups and prepare the restaurant for special events.
Minimum Qualifications:
- Graduate or Undergraduate of any Hospitality Course.
- Proven experience in the position of interest.
- Physically fit and with no large, visible tattoos.
- With good communication and memorization skills.
- Great interpersonal and teamwork skills.
- Ability to remain composed, particularly during stressful or uncomfortable circumstances.
- Willingness to work on a shifting schedule.
- Willingness to perform additional duties to facilitate the restaurant's operations, as needed.
